Phonological Activation in Bilinguals: Evidence from Interlingual Homograph Naming.
Jared, Debra; Szucs, Carrie
Bilingualism: Language and Cognition, v5 n3 p225-39 Dec 2002
Investigated whether bilinguals simultaneously activate phonological representations from both of their languages when reading words in just one. Critical stimuli were interlingual homographs that were low in frequency in the target language of the study (English) and high in frequency in the nontarget language (French) (Author/VWL)
